1,4,4,5,5,6-Hexafluoro-cyclohexene, also known as hexafluorocyclohexene, is a cyclic organic compound with the molecular formula C6H4F6. It is a colorless liquid that is insoluble in water and has a boiling point of 47-48°C. 1,4,4,5,5,6-Hexafluor-cyclohexen is characterized by the presence of six fluorine atoms and four hydrogen atoms, with the fluorine atoms being arranged in a specific pattern around the cyclohexene ring. Hexafluoro-cyclohexene is an important intermediate in the synthesis of various fluorinated compounds, such as fluoropolymers and fluorinated pharmaceuticals, due to its unique properties and reactivity. It is typically produced through the dehydrofluorination of hexafluorocyclohexane or through the Diels-Alder reaction of tetrafluoroethylene with cyclopentadiene. The compound is also known for its potential use as a refrigerant and as a building block in the development of new materials with enhanced properties.
